Hypertension is the most common preventable cause of cardiovascular illness. Home blood stress monitoring (HBPM) is a self-monitoring software that can be integrated into the care for patients with hypertension and is recommended by major guidelines. A growing physique of proof helps the benefits of affected person HBPM in contrast with office-primarily based monitoring: these include improved control of BP, diagnosis of white-coat hypertension and prediction of cardiovascular danger. Furthermore, HBPM is cheaper and simpler to perform than 24-hour ambulatory BP monitoring (ABPM). All HBPM devices require validation, nonetheless, as inaccurate readings have been present in a high proportion of displays. New technology options a longer inflatable area inside the cuff that wraps all the best way spherical the arm, rising the ‘acceptable range’ of placement and thus lowering the impact of cuff placement on reading accuracy, thereby overcoming the constraints of current gadgets.


However, even supposing the affect of BP on CV danger is supported by one in all the best our bodies of clinical trial information in medicine, few clinical research have been dedicated to the difficulty of BP measurement and its validity. Studies additionally lack consistency in the reporting of BP measurements and some don't even provide particulars on how BP monitoring was carried out. This article goals to debate the benefits and disadvantages of dwelling BP monitoring (HBPM) and examines new expertise geared toward improving its accuracy. Office BP measurement is associated with several disadvantages. A research in which repeated BP measurements have been made over a 2-week period underneath research examine conditions found variations of as a lot as 30 mmHg with no remedy adjustments.
